During the passed days it was announced the beginning of a new project of Green Balkans “Life for Lesser Kestrel” LIFE19 NAT/BG/001017. The project presented at the course of the celebration, dedicated to the 25 years anniversary since the establishment of the Wildlife Rescue Centre in Stara Zagora, and it is funded by Programm LIFE of the European Commission.

The celebration was visted by more than 250 guests from around the country, representatives from the state and municipal administration such as Dr. Stefka Zdravkova, Regional Governor of Haskovo Region and Mr. Krasimir Chervilov – Deputy Regional Governor of Stara Zagora Region, representatives of the Ministry of Environment and Water and scientific institutions represented by Dr. Todor Stoyanchev, Deputy Dean of the Veterinary-medical Faculty at Trakia University in Stara Zagora, NGO’s, veterinaries and farmers, companies from different business fields, environment students, veterinary students and other natural sciences.

All of them got aquainted with the new project team, its basic directions of its work, more important goals to achieve in the five years frame of realization too. It was emphasized on the important role played by the Wildlife Rescue Centre in Stara Zagora of Green Balkans, as well as the steps they would take to upgrade what was achieved until the present moment by the organization when they fulfilled the previous project to reintroduce the species in the country.
